What Are Walk-in Interview Jobs in Apollo?
Apollo Hospitals regularly conducts walk-in interviews across its branches in India. These are open hiring events where candidates can visit the hospital location on a scheduled date without prior appointment.
Common Roles Offered
Walk-in interviews at Apollo usually cover:
- Staff Nurses
- Lab Technicians
- Pharmacists
- Front Office Executives
- Billing Executives
- Housekeeping Staff
- Duty Medical Officers

Step-by-Step Guide to Apply for Walk-in Interview Jobs in Apollo
Step 1: Check Official Announcements
Visit the official website of Apollo Hospitals or check trusted job portals. Look for:
- Date and time of interview
- Venue details
- Required qualifications
- Documents to bring
Avoid relying only on social media posts. Always verify from official sources.
Step 2: Prepare Your Documents
Carry:
- Updated resume (3–4 copies)
- Educational certificates (original + photocopies)
- ID proof
- Passport-size photos
- Experience letters (if any)
Step 3: Dress Professionally
Even though it’s a walk-in, treat it like a formal interview.
- Wear clean and simple formal attire
- Keep grooming neat
- Avoid heavy perfumes or flashy accessories
Step 4: Prepare for Basic Interview Questions
Common questions include:
- Tell me about yourself.
- Why do you want to work at Apollo?
- What is your clinical experience?
- How do you handle emergency situations?
